Abstract:
This paper critically highlights the history and the current use of the concept of mindfulness, from its Buddhist roots via medical application and organizational consulting into its application as a management tool. The paper puts the concept of mindfulness in its historical context, mentions some of the controversies the ‘brand of mindfulness’ has stirred and prefers the term ‘being mindful’ over ‘mindfulness’. Abstract:
Mindfulness is an actively engaged state of mind when an individual is attuned to their surrounding multi-sensory elements. Mindful learning experiences during youth programs may enhance learning and the overall quality of experiences. We developed, executed, and evaluated an end-of-day structured mindfulness experience during a 4-H travel camp. In this paper we summarize the program and its outcomes and share details we believe will assist other youth professionals who may want to build structured mindfulness experiences into their own programs. Abstract:
Graduates’ failure to pause, reflect and draw on their learning to predict the legal consequences of their publishing can result in fines, damages and even jail terms. This article reports upon a survey of more than one hundred media law students in courses at an Australian university over two years where mindfulness-based cognitive reflections were used as a teaching tool. The author and colleague developed a conceptual map to explain the potentialities of mindfulness-based meditation in journalism education.
